There are fears in Europe that US President Donald Trump may end his support for Ukraine, disappointed by the failure of his own efforts to resolve the war unleashed by Russia.
The White House has increased pressure on Ukraine and its allies to force them to conclude an agreement with Moscow, causing concern in European capitals and Washington that Trump agrees with Russia's demands, the Financial Times reports.
On Sunday, Trump criticized European and Ukrainian leaders on social media for failing to make progress in ending the war.
Since the US presented its 28-point plan to President Zelensky last week, Kiev's European allies have called for further work on the proposal.
One European official expressed concern that Trump could withdraw support for Ukraine out of frustration, leaving Zelensky and his country in a precarious position.
“This is a scenario we are obviously preparing for,” he said.
European diplomats expect further meetings between France, Germany, and the UK over the next week. Other possible participants include the leaders of Poland and Finland and NATO Secretary General Mark Rutte.
“We are trying to come up with something that could be offered as a counterproposal,” the European diplomat said.
